The Boiler Grant is a government-funded scheme providing free and subsidized replacement boilers to those in need as part of the ECO4 scheme. If your current boiler is broken, over 7 years old, has a relatively low efficiency (for example, a G rating) or is un-repairable, then you could qualify for a completely free replacement boiler installation, well within the ECO scheme. The Affordable Warmth Obligation, such as Free Boiler Grants and free insulation upgrades, may provide funding towards new A-rated boilers. Which in turn has proven to save households hundreds of pounds per annum off their energy bills and help lower carbon emissions across the UK.
You may qualify for this grant if you:
Your Home: You rent your house or apartment (with landlord's permission).
Your Boiler: Your existing boiler is no longer efficient, broken or over 7 years old.
Your benefits: You or somebody in your household gets benefits like:
Universal Credit
Pension Credit
Child Tax Credit
Income-related ESA/JSA
Your EPC Rating: This property has very low energy efficiency (EPC D-G).

Want to ditch that old gas or oil boiler? The government's Boiler Upgrade Scheme (BUS) provides grants of up to £7,500 for switching to a clean, renewable heat pump. As accredited installers, we are here to support you every step of the way, from application through to installation; working with zero-carbon plans couldn't be easier.
The Boiler Upgrade Scheme is a new government policy designed to support homeowners in England and Wales in transitioning to low-carbon heating. The grant provides a significant financial incentive to replace the current form of fossil fuel (gas, oil, or electricity) with a lower-cost, more efficient renewable alternative.
There are two different types you can select from when it comes to systems:
Air Source Heat Pumps: Harvest heat from the air to heat your house and water, even in freezing conditions.
Geothermal Heat Pumps: Utilise constant temperatures beneath the earth to provide extremely efficient heating and cooling all year long.
You probably qualify for the grant if you satisfy these conditions:
You hold a property of your own in England or Wales.
You are currently swapping out an antique fossil fuel or electric heating system.
Your home has an up-to-date EPC, which shows no open recommendations for loft or cavity wall insulation.
New builds (except self-builds) are also not applicable. Do you qualify? Our agency offers you a free no-obligation assessment of your eligibility.
The grant cuts the upfront cost of making the switch dramatically:
Grants of up to £7,500 towards air source or ground source heat pump purchase and installation.
